Explore Bangkok: 5-Day Itinerary

Sunday, December 24

Start your Bangkok adventure by immersing yourself in the vibrant atmosphere of Chatuchak Weekend Market. In the morning, wander through the maze of stalls selling everything from clothing to antiques. Grab a refreshing Thai iced tea and indulge in some tasty street food. In the afternoon, visit the majestic Grand Palace and Wat Phra Kaew, the Temple of the Emerald Buddha. Marvel at the intricate architecture and rich history. As the evening sets in, head to Khao San Road, a bustling backpacker hub. Enjoy a delicious dinner at one of the many street food stalls and soak in the lively atmosphere.

  • Chatuchak Weekend Market: Estimated cost - Free, Time spent - 3-4 hours
  • Grand Palace and Wat Phra Kaew: Estimated cost - 500 THB (includes entrance fee),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Khao San Road: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- Evening
Monday, December 25

On this Christmas Day, start your day with a visit to Wat Arun, also known as the Temple of Dawn. Admire its stunning spires and panoramic views of the city from the top. In the afternoon, explore the historic district of Chinatown. Stroll through Yaowarat Road, sample delicious street food, and visit the colorful Chinese shrines. As the evening approaches, take a relaxing boat ride along the Chao Phraya River. Enjoy the scenic views and witness the city come alive with sparkling lights.

  • Wat Arun: Estimated cost - 100 THB (entrance fee),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Chinatown: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Chao Phraya River boat ride: Estimated cost - 100-200 THB, Time spent - Evening
Tuesday, December 26

Embark on a cultural journey by visiting Wat Pho, the Temple of the Reclining Buddha, in the morning. Marvel at the giant golden statue and indulge in a traditional Thai massage at the on-site massage school. In the afternoon, explore the vibrant neighborhood of Sukhumvit. Shop at Terminal 21, a mall with themed floors representing different world cities, and enjoy a delicious meal at one of the trendy restaurants in the area. As the evening unfolds, experience the lively nightlife of Bangkok at Soi Cowboy or Nana Plaza.

  • Wat Pho: Estimated cost - 100 THB (entrance fee),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Sukhumvit: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- 3-4 hours
  • Soi Cowboy or Nana Plaza: Estimated cost - Varies, Time spent - Evening
Wednesday, December 27

Escape the city's hustle and bustle by taking a day trip to Ayutthaya, the ancient capital of Thailand. Explore the UNESCO World Heritage Site and marvel at the magnificent ruins of temples and palaces. Rent a bicycle to explore the historical park or take a boat tour along the Chao Phraya River. Immerse yourself in the rich history and serene atmosphere of this cultural treasure. Return to Bangkok in the evening and unwind with a relaxing Thai massage.

  • Ayutthaya day trip: Estimated cost - 1,000-1,500 THB (includes transportation and entrance fees), Time spent - Full day
  • Thai massage: Estimated cost - 300-500 THB, Time spent - 1-2 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For a unique experience, consider exploring the lesser-known Phraeng Phuthon community. This hidden gem offers a glimpse into traditional Thai architecture and local way of life. Visit the Baan Bat community, where artisans have been making alms bowls by hand for centuries. Another local favorite is the Talad Rot Fai Srinakarin Night Market. Discover vintage treasures, indulge in delicious street food, and soak up the lively atmosphere.
